What is Misted Double Glazing?
Misted double glazing occurs when moisture gets trapped in between the panes of double-glazed glass. This leads to a foggy or misty look, therefore compromising the visual appeal and energy effectiveness of windows. While it is mostly a cosmetic problem, misting can indicate underlying problems with the seals of the double-glazed units, which might necessitate repairs or replacement.
Reasons For Misted Double Glazing
Several factors can add to the misting of double-glazed windows. Understanding these causes can help house owners take preventive measures and act swiftly when problems arise. Here's a list of common causes:
- Seal Failure:
- Over time, the seals that hold the gas in between the panes can weaken due to age, temperature level changes, or physical stress.
- Temperature Fluctuations:
- Rapid temperature modifications can trigger the seals to broaden and contract, resulting in ultimate failure.
- Poor Installation:
- Inadequate installation practices can cause lasting concerns such as improperly sealed windows.
- Wear and Tear:
- As windows age, wear and tear can result in fractures or gaps that enable moisture to enter.
- Production Defects:
- Occasionally, defective products or manufacturing procedures can result in premature misting.

Cost of Misted Double Glazing Repairs in the UK
The cost of repairing misted double glazing can vary commonly based upon a number of aspects, including the measurements of the windows, the degree of the damage, and whether the existing units require changing or simply sealing.
- Misted Unit Replacement: Costs can range from ₤ 250 to ₤ 800 or more per window.
- Seal Replacement: The expense can generally lie between ₤ 100 and ₤ 300.
- Dehumidification Services: These might cost in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150, depending upon the company.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. The length of time does double glazing last?
Double glazing typically lasts anywhere in between 20 to 30 years, however this lifespan can be impacted by ecological aspects and the quality of setup.
2. Can I avoid misting in my double-glazed windows?
Routine maintenance checks and guaranteeing appropriate setup can help in reducing the risk of misting. Consider addressing any noticeable fractures or wear immediately.
3. Is it worth repairing misted double glazing?
Oftentimes, it deserves repairing instead of changing, especially if the frames remain in excellent condition. Replacement should be thought about if the insulation worth is compromised.
4. How can I inform if my double glazing has lost its seal?
Noticeable condensation in between glass panes is a strong indicator that the seal has failed.
